
The Kalvarayan hills are situated 150-km north west of
Chidambaram on the western
side of Kallakurichi Taluk (also spelt as Taluka). Spread over an area of
600-sq-kms. approximately with the height ranging from 315mts. to
1,190mts. these hills offer a temperate climate and quiet solicitude.
There is a botanical garden on the hills. There are two waterfalls here.
The area is ideal for trekking. Before going on a trek carry a sleeping
bag, drinking water, warm clothes, medicines and any food supplies for an
emergency.
Air: The nearest airport is at
Trichy.
Rail: The nearest convenient railway station is
Chidambaram on the
Chennai-Trichy
meter-gauge line, which is connected to the temple towns of
Rameswaram, Thanjavur, and Kumbakonam.
Road: Regular buses are available from
Chidambaram
Trekkers can accommodate themselves in the nearby local village, but for a convenient stay one can stay at the hotels in Chidambaram.
